Abstract

Understanding customer purchase behavior is essential for organizations seeking to strengthen customer engagement, refine marketing strategies, and improve business performance in highly competitive digital markets. This study develops a hybrid Customer Segmentation and Structural Equation Modeling (SEM) framework to examine the determinants of customer purchasing behavior and purchasing intention. The proposed framework integrates K-Means clustering with SEM, enabling the simultaneous identification of homogeneous customer groups and assessment of structural relationships among Customer Demographics (CD), Product Preference (PP), Purchasing Behavior (PB), Customer Segmentation (CS), and Purchasing Intention (PI). A dataset containing 8,000 customer records was analyzed through data preprocessing, exploratory data analysis, clustering, and structural modeling. The K-Means results identified four meaningful customer segments: Budget Customers, Regular Customers, Premium Customers, and High-Value Customers. The SEM results indicated a satisfactory overall model fit (CFI = 0.953, TLI = 0.947, RMSEA = 0.051, and SRMR = 0.043). Product Preference was found to exert a significant positive effect on Purchasing Behavior (β = 0.451, p < 0.001), while Purchasing Behavior demonstrated the strongest direct influence on Purchasing Intention (β = 0.536, p < 0.001). In addition, Customer Segmentation significantly mediated the relationship between Purchasing Behavior and Purchasing Intention. These findings confirm that combining machine-learning-based customer segmentation with SEM provides a robust analytical framework for understanding both customer heterogeneity and behavioral mechanisms. The proposed approach offers practical value for personalized marketing, customer targeting, resource allocation, and data-driven strategic decision-making across increasingly complex digital commerce environments.
